This course is designed for maintenance technicians, reliability engineers, and inspectors entering the field of predictive maintenance. You will learn the fundamental theory, measurement principles, and basic diagnostic techniques required to achieve CMVA Category I certification.
By the end of the program you will be able to collect vibration data, interpret basic vibration signatures, identify common fault conditions, and generate a machine health report.
